Video game developer and publisher Paradox Interactive has announced that, after the strong initial sales performance of War of the Roses, it has made it an official franchise in its catalog, with a separate development team lead by executive producer Gordon Van Dyke.

The new team leader stated, “There is no doubt that War of the Roses has been an ambitious project for us.”

He added, “The game’s reception from players has exceeded expectations and we are truly grateful for the continued support from the community. We’ll continue to improve the game and add substantial content for all players.”
